Clogged drain repair services focus on identifying and resolving blockages within residential or commercial drainage systems. When drains become obstructed, it can lead to slow drainage, foul odors, or even backups that affect plumbing fixtures such as sinks, toilets, and floor drains. Professionals typically use specialized tools and techniques to locate the source of the clog, whether it’s a buildup of debris, grease, hair, or foreign objects, and then work to clear the obstruction effectively. The goal is to restore proper flow and prevent further plumbing issues caused by persistent clogs.

This service helps address common drainage problems that can disrupt daily routines and cause property damage if left untreated. Blockages can result from a variety of causes, including accumulated waste, tree root intrusion, or aging pipes. Clogged drain repair services not only resolve existing issues but also often include assessments to identify underlying causes, helping to prevent future blockages. Timely repairs can reduce the risk of pipe damage, water damage, and the need for more extensive plumbing work down the line.

Properties that frequently require clogged drain repair services include residential homes, apartment complexes, and small commercial buildings. In homes, kitchen sinks, bathroom drains, and laundry lines are common sites of clogs. Commercial properties such as restaurants or retail stores may experience drain issues due to high usage or grease buildup. Additionally, properties with older plumbing systems are more prone to blockages caused by pipe corrosion or root intrusion, making regular maintenance and prompt repairs essential for maintaining proper drainage.

The overview below groups typical Clogged Drain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Manteca, CA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Repair Costs - The typical cost for unclogging drains ranges from $150 to $350, depending on the severity of the blockage and the plumbing system. For example, simple drain snaking might cost around $150, while more extensive repairs could reach $350 or more.

Service Charges - Service fees for clogged drain repairs generally fall between $100 and $200, which may include inspection and basic clearing. Additional charges could apply if specialized equipment or extensive work is needed.

Material Expenses - Costs for replacement parts or specialized tools can add $50 to $200 to the overall expense. These are often necessary if the clog is caused by damaged pipes or obstructions requiring parts replacement.

Factors Influencing Cost - The final cost varies based on pipe accessibility, location, and the complexity of the clog. Local service providers can provide estimates tailored to specific situations in Manteca, CA and nearby areas.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es drains to become clogged? Drains can become clogged due to the buildup of debris such as hair, grease, soap scum, or foreign objects that obstruct the flow of water.

How can I tell if my drain is clogged? Signs of a clogged drain include slow draining water, gurgling sounds, or unpleasant odors emanating from the drain.

Are chemical drain cleaners effective for clearing clogs? Chemical drain cleaners may temporarily dissolve minor blockages, but for persistent or severe clogs, professional repair services are recommended.

How long does clogged drain rep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the severity of the clog, but most repairs can be completed within a few hours by local service providers.

What should I do if my drain remains clogged after attempting DIY methods? If DIY efforts do not resolve the issue, contacting a professional drain repair service is advised to safely and effectively clear the clog.
